**Vendor note: Inkmill markdown pipeline**

Rendering for Parchway docs is outsourced to Inkmill under an annual contract, renewing each March. They handle sanitization and PDF export; we own the upload queue. SLA: 4-hour response on rendering failures. Escalate only after two failed retries. Their support desk is reachable at the address below.

billing contact of hahaf-baguf = zorael.tammir.jorius@sivrelhq.internal

Ticket TR-887: Transcode workers dropping DB connections

Farm nodes at the Calder site lose their job-ledger connection roughly every 90 minutes, stalling the Morvane transcoding queue. Suspect the NAT gateway recycling idle sessions. Workaround: set keepalive to 55s in worker config. Repro requires hitting the ledger directly; use the connection string below.

warehouse DSN: mssql://rusdor_svc:0FSWCn9@db-951a.paliqforge.local:5432/ulawyn

Onboarding: cron migration to Weftline. Legacy cron jobs on the batch hosts are being moved into the Weftline workflow engine. During migration both may fire; Weftline wins, cron entries are commented out as each job cuts over. If a job double-runs or goes silent, check the cutover tracker first. The tracker and rollback steps are on the page below.

wiki page, fajof-tajef: https://vault.tolvaqio.corp/board/pipeline/pages/ticket/c20d7f984bcc9e12

Subject: FD leak hunt — fix ready for review

Team, the leaked-file-descriptor hunt in the Corvid ingest daemon is done. Root cause: the Tanager parser opened a spill file per malformed record and only closed it on the success path. The fix adds a deferred close plus a regression test that asserts the descriptor count stays flat over 10k bad records. Please review carefully before the Hollowbrook cutover. The candidate build is referenced below.

pipeline stamp: htk3_69f